
Quiero usar el comando sendmail
para enviar correos electrónicos. Normalmente funciona -> Puedo enviar correos a mi correo electrónico (@icloud.com) y funciona sin problemas. Pero si quiero enviar a una dirección @gmail, no funciona. No hay ningún mensaje de error ni nada por el estilo, es solo el correo electrónico que no llega a la dirección de correo electrónico. ¿Qué puedo hacer? ¿O cuál podría ser el problema?
Esta vez recibí un mensaje del subsistema de entrega de correo:
The original message was received at Mon, 18 Sep 2023 08:23:16 +0200
from localhost [127.0.0.1]
----- The following addresses had permanent fatal errors -----
< (The mail address @gmail) >
(reason: 550-5.7.1 [ (IPv6) ] Our system has detected that)
----- Transcript of session follows -----
... while talking to gmail-smtp-in.l.google.com.:
DATA
<<< 550-5.7.1 [ (IPv6 Address) ] Our system has detected that
<<< 550-5.7.1 this message does not meet IPv6 sending guidelines regarding PTR
<<< 550-5.7.1 records and authentication. Please review
<<< 550-5.7.1 https://support.google.com/mail/?p=IPv6AuthError for more information
<<< 550 5.7.1 . ck9-20020a170906c44900b0099de8722195si7349253ejb.747 - gsmtp
554 5.0.0 Service unavailable
Y:
Reporting-MTA: dns; WS301.WS301.intern
Received-From-MTA: DNS; localhost
Arrival-Date: Mon, 18 Sep 2023 08:23:16 +0200
Final-Recipient: RFC822;(@gmail.com address)
Action: failed
Status: 5.7.1
Remote-MTA: DNS; gmail-smtp-in.l.google.com
Diagnostic-Code: SMTP; 550-5.7.1 [ (IPv6) ] Our system has detected that
Last-Attempt-Date: Mon, 18 Sep 2023 08:23:17 +0200
Respuesta1
El mensaje de error es bastante específico:
Nuestro sistema ha detectado que este mensaje no cumple con las pautas de envío de IPv6 con respecto a los registros PTR y la autenticación. Por favor revisehttps://support.google.com/mail/?p=IPv6AuthErrorpara más información
Seguir el enlace ofrece muchos consejos generalmente sensatos. Sin embargo, los detalles de Gmail comienzan en la sección "Siga las prácticas recomendadas para el servidor de correo electrónico":
Su dirección IP de envío debe tener un registro PTR. Los registros PTR verifican que el nombre de host de envío esté asociado con la dirección IP de envío. Cada dirección IP debe asignarse a un nombre de host en el registro PTR. El nombre de host especificado en el registro PTR debe tener un DNS directo que haga referencia a la dirección IP de envío.
Un error de autorización de IPv6 podría significar que el registro PTR del servidor de envío no utiliza IPv6. Si utiliza un proveedor de servicios de correo electrónico, confirme que esté utilizando un registro PTR IPv6.
Si aún tiene problemas con la entrega de correo después de seguir las pautas de este artículo, intenteSolución de problemas para remitentes con problemas de entrega de correo electrónico.
A su vez, seguir allí conduce a esta declaración de Google,
- Firmar mensajes conDKIM. Gmail no autentica mensajes firmados con claves que utilicen menos de 1024 bits.
- Publicar unRegistro SPF.
- Publicar unPolítica DMARC